A legendary thief sets his sights on the Mona Lisa, da Vinci’s iconic painting residing at Le Louvre museum in Paris. He recruits two young strangers to help him — a sharp Italian cybercrime expert and a swaggering French explosives specialist — before revealing they are long-lost siblings and that he is their father. Thrown into a chaotic reunion they never asked for, this new family must learn to work together — and try not to kill each other — if they want any chance at pulling off the heist of the century.
